Our verdict is Uncertain significance. Variant got 2 ACMG points: 2P and 0B. PM2

The NM_017419.3(ASIC5):c.790C>A(p.Pro264Thr) variant causes a missense change. The variant allele was found at a frequency of 0.00017 in 1,613,548 control chromosomes in the GnomAD database, with no homozygous occurrence. Variant has been reported in ClinVar as Uncertain significance (★).

ASIC5 (HGNC:17537): (acid sensing ion channel subunit family member 5) This gene belongs to the amiloride-sensitive Na+ channel and degenerin (NaC/DEG) family, members of which have been identified in many animal species ranging from the nematode to human. The amiloride-sensitive Na(+) channel encoded by this gene is primarily expressed in the small intestine, however, its exact function is not known. [provided by RefSeq, Jul 2008]

Uncertain significance, criteria provided, single submitterclinical testingAmbry GeneticsAug 16, 2021The c.790C>A (p.P264T) alteration is located in exon 5 (coding exon 5) of the ASIC5 gene. This alteration results from a C to A substitution at nucleotide position 790, causing the proline (P) at amino acid position 264 to be replaced by a threonine (T).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
